Output 51d6a3a6468c282044504aaa4d8ff629ca142da291ee7e2684241b80cff27ecb:1

value
3415154514
script pubkey
OP_0 OP_PUSHBYTES_20 294c0dc0ffc6e8398e45788a82644817fbe369f1
address
tb1q99xqms8lcm5rnrj90z9gyezgzla7x603zes29e
transaction
51d6a3a6468c282044504aaa4d8ff629ca142da291ee7e2684241b80cff27ecb
confirmations
108434
spent
true